Lift Kit Install

Ok, got my 5" Allsports Axle Lift (ASM-E5G) for my 95 gas medalist today thanks to Radical Golf Carts.
The directions don't go into detail and my cart stays at the campground where I will be installing with no power or air tools so I'm just trying to figure things out beforehand.

The optional Shackles, do these go in place of the rear stock ones?

The optional shock stud extensions, are these for the rear shocks?

Tie rod tubes, do these change anything or can the stock ones remain?

Any other suggestions or thoughts?
 

dirtysouth

Cartaholic - V.I.P. Sponsor
Optional shackles are for finished ride height. If you have worn rear springs, the shackles will make up the difference and you will need the shock extensions if you use the shackles.

Tie rod tubes are 1" longer than OE, the axle is 2" wider than OE, so the tie rods make up for the added width.

Ok, I need help...
Trying to get the tie rod tubes apart.
Two are frozen. I was able to use a pipe wrench on one to break free.
The two on the end I used a pickle fork and they brook free.
I then tried to use the fork to pop the one off at the steering arm, that seems to be frozen as well.
So I have two tie rod ends frozen in the tubes and one tie rod tapered end frozen at the steering arm.
Does anyone know if auto stores carry a substitute replacement?
 

dirtysouth

Cartaholic - V.I.P. Sponsor
Penetrating oil... Leave the rod ends in the holes. It'll give ya more control and leverage to free them up. If ya have a pickle fork, the joint will brake free. Try driving the fork under the joint and then smack the arm next to the joint.

I was putting the old spindel/wheel hub on the new lift.
I think they are called king pins, they tapped out of the stock axle but they fit real tight in the new one, should the top and bottom hole be sanded to remove the paint?
 

dirtysouth

Cartaholic - V.I.P. Sponsor
The king pin holes can be sanded, but it's not necessary. The pins will be tight on the new axle due to the thickness of the powder coat. Make sure to drive the pins in straight. They should tap in, if you have to beat on the pin, then it is misaligned to the lower hole in the axle.
